Originally Posted by sfazngiants
car looks clean, looks good. i think the hood goes with the car well.did you install the jdm side markers your self? thinking about installing some. do you know if there's a DIY for it. i kind of remember seeing one but i forgot where
Thanks, and yes, I installed the sidemarkers myself, I used a dremel tool with plenty of cutting blades. All I did was tape up the area, used my template that i got from either honda-t3ch or jdmuniv3rse or something (can't remember). then I slowly cut away keeping the metal cool, then slightly filed away the edges and used some left over touch up paint. Then wired and loomed everything to look like factory.
